I suppose Clifton demonstrates how important team structure and the defensive play of forwards is to the success of the team and individual players on it. One affects the other. In the system he came from, his flaws were minimized, covered up for, and he thrived. It allowed him to hit a lot and play aggressively. In this system (?) his flaws are exposed and he doesn't get much support and so he flounders. 

I saw Risto the other night in a Philly game. They have him as 6D and they have kept it simple for him. He stays in his lane, drops back quick and still hits like a ton of bricks. Seems to be working in that somewhat limited capacity. I think Clifton's case has similarities.
